There are courts at the municipal, county, state, and federal levels, each with its own set of criminal records. A county may be considered a province or a specific region, and there are almost three thousand counties in the United States. Each county court maintains its own set of criminal records. Normally the cases held at the county level include misdemeanors and felonies that are not reported at the federal level.

Understanding Tort

Tort law is different from the laws of contract, restitution, and the criminal law. Contract law protects the parties involved when expectations arise from promises, restitution prevents unjust enrichment and compensation for wrongdoing, and criminal law punishes crimes that are so severe (like murder, rape, fraud) that society has a direct interest in preventing and dealing with them. Note that many wrongs can result in liability to both the state (as criminal activity and proceedings) and to the victims (as torts).



The Business of Torture

On January 16, 2003, the European Court of Human Rights agreed – more than two years after the applications have been filed – to hear six cases filed by Chechens against Russia. The claimants accused the Russian military of torture and indiscriminate killings. The Court has ruled in the past against the Russian Federation and awarded assorted plaintiffs thousands of euros per case in compensation.
